Check out the <a href=\"\/blackbook-series\">Blackbook Series<\/a> \u2013 my premium guides that break down exactly what works, what doesn&#8217;t, and how to build a stack that actually moves the needle on your health.<\/em><\/p>\n            <\/div>\n\n            <div class=\"faq-section\">\n                <h2>Frequently Asked Questions<\/h2>\n\n                <div class=\"faq-item\">\n                    <div class=\"faq-question\">Q: Are supplements regulated by the FDA?<\/div>\n                    <div class=\"faq-answer\">A: The FDA regulates supplements as foods, not drugs. This means companies don&#8217;t have to prove safety or effectiveness before selling them. However, the FDA can take action if problems arise after products hit the market.<\/div>\n                <\/div>\n\n                <div class=\"faq-item\">\n                    <div class=\"faq-question\">Q: What are proprietary blends and why should I avoid them?<\/div>\n                    <div class=\"faq-answer\">A: Proprietary blends allow companies to hide the exact amounts of each ingredient. They might list 500mg of a &#8220;Focus Blend&#8221; containing 10 ingredients, but you won&#8217;t know if you&#8217;re getting 1mg or 100mg of the ingredient you actually want.<\/div>\n                <\/div>\n\n                <div class=\"faq-item\">\n                    <div class=\"faq-question\">Q: How do I know if my supplement is actually working?<\/div>\n                    <div class=\"faq-answer\">A: The best approach is objective testing: blood panels for nutrients like vitamin D, B12, and omega-3s. For subjective benefits like energy or mood, keep a daily log for at least 30 days before and after starting a supplement.<\/div>\n                <\/div>\n\n                <div class=\"faq-item\">\n                    <div class=\"faq-question\">Q: Should I trust supplement studies posted on company websites?<\/div>\n                    <div class=\"faq-answer\">A: Be extremely skeptical. Many companies cherry-pick positive results, cite animal studies as if they apply to humans, or reference studies done on completely different formulations. Always look for peer-reviewed research from independent sources.<\/div>\n                <\/div>\n\n                <div class=\"faq-item\">\n                    <div class=\"faq-question\">Q: How can I save money on supplements without hurting my health?<\/div>\n                    <div class=\"faq-answer\">A: Focus on quality over quantity. Start with proven basics like vitamin D, magnesium, and omega-3s. Avoid overpriced blends and buy single-ingredient supplements in bioavailable forms. Most people can cut their supplement spending by 60-70% while getting better results.<\/div>\n                <\/div>\n\n                <div class=\"faq-item\">\n                    <div class=\"faq-question\">Q: What&#8217;s the difference between synthetic and natural vitamins?<\/div>\n                    <div class=\"faq-answer\">A: It depends on the specific vitamin. Some (like vitamin C) are virtually identical whether synthetic or natural. Others (like vitamin E or folate) have significantly different forms that affect absorption and effectiveness. This is why ingredient quality matters more than marketing claims.<\/div>\n                <\/div>\n            <\/div>\n\n            <div class=\"related-links\">\n                <h3>Related Articles:<\/h3>\n                <a href=\"\/blog\/magnesium-forms-timing\">The Magnesium Mistake 90% of People Make<\/a>\n                <a href=\"\/blog\/vitamin-d-absorption-timing\">Why Your Vitamin D Supplement Isn&#8217;t Working<\/a>\n                <a href=\"\/blog\/relief-factor-analysis\">Relief Factor Ingredients: What You&#8217;re Really Paying For<\/a>\n            <\/div>\n        <\/div>\n    <\/div>\n<\/body>\n<\/html>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Why Most People Are Getting Ripped Off The $193 Billion Supplement Industry: Why Most People Are Getting Ripped Off | Supplement Sensei The $193 Billion Supplement Industry Why Most People Are Getting Ripped Off Editor&#8217;s Note: This is our cornerstone article.
